She was beautiful, the childhood. In the summer we are top of the Tschaufen, all summer, just up there on the mountain with a relative of my mom, and she looked after us well. Since her daughter was with. That was the best time, really, to freedom. That was nice. And afterwards, the Nazis came and we were in school all German children and the teachers Italians. must And of course one has learned little Italian, and after school me and my sister's parents to the Institute to Trent, where, in order to learn Italian because it was necessary if one has in Bolzano on the offices, because of documents and such. Since all workers were Italian. And there we have to just Italian. For three years I was down, until the war broke out, and then back home in the business with her mother to work and the sisters too. The Katakombenschule. So my aunts in Seven calibration, which is a fraction of Terlan who knew a teacher in Bolzano, which has come out every week and has given us lessons and every time in another house. We were a group of children, always in a different house entirely in secret, that's not something noticeable. And in Seven Oaks at the aunts, as they have always performed puppet theater, so it looks like this, if someone comes, that we play as only. .. There is of course no one has asked anything. That would have been a disaster.
